I just bought a car from Atlantic chevy.They gave me all test drives on empty tanks(actually had to stop to get gas during one drive and they fill their cars with EMPIRE gas).
Bought my car,they gave me car with only 1/8-1/4 tank of gas.I bitched and they gave me a $30 voucher telling me the cars usually leave the lot with a half tank of gas.They also almost let me leave lot without front license plate on.
A week later ,I noticed all my sales paperwork were dated wrong,showing I bought the car 2 weeks earlier than I did.Because of that my extended warranty started on wrong date,my 1st payment was due 2 weeks after I bought car and the payoff on my trade- in is still showing $88 due.They fixed the warranty paperwork,told me they can't do anything on 1st payment date,and although said they would fix trade-in money owed ,it's been almost a week with no change.
Some service for a $40,000 purchase.

It's interesting you say that cause before I went to Atlantic chevy,I had gone to two other dealers near me(one in smithtown near mall and one off of 112 in coram).Neither one gave me the impression they were really trying to sell me the car.One guy wouldn't give me a decent price on trade-in,started eating Ho-ho's in front of me and didn't even try to get the hook in by offering a test drive.Same with the other place - guy never left his seat.Keep in mind- I walked in these places with basically $20,000 in my pocket.I left both places bewildered thinking the camaro was selling itself.
